Security Trends in Cloud Computing
Zero Trust Security Models
Zero trust security models are becoming essential in cloud computing environments. This approach assumes that threats can originate from both outside and inside the network. Therefore, verification is required for every access request. Trust is earned, not given.
He emphasizes that implementing zero trust involves fontinuous monitoring and validation of user identities. This process enhances security posture significantly. It’s a proactive strategy.
Additionally , zero trust architecture often incorporates micro-segmentation, which limits lateral movement within the network. This tactic minimizes potential damage from breaches. It’s a critical safeguard.
Data Encryption and Privacy Measures
Data encryption and privacy measures are critical components of cloud security strategies. These techniques protect sensitive information from unauthorized access code and breaches. Security is paramount in finance.
He notes that end-to-end encryption ensures that data remains secure durimg transmission and storage. This method significantly reduces the risk of data leaks . It’s a necessary safeguard.
Moreover, implementing robust access controls further enhances data privacy. By restricting access to authorized users only, organizations can mitigate potential threats. This approach is essential for compliance.

Cost Management and Optimization Strategies
Understanding Cloud Pricing Models
Understanding cloud pricing models is essential for effective cost management. Various models, such as pay-as-you-go and reserved instances, offer different financial implications. Each model has its advantages.
He notes that pay-as-you-go allows flexibility, enabling businesses to scale resources based on demand. This adaptability can lead to cost savings. It’s a smart choice.
On the other hand, reserved instances provide significant discounts for long-term commitments. This option is beneficial for predictable workloads. It’s a strategic investment.
Cost Optimization Tools and Techniques
Cost optimization tools and techniques are vital for managing cloud expenses effectively. Utilizing cloud cost management platforms can provide insights into spending patterns. This analysis helps identify areas for savings.
He emphasizes the importance of rightsizing resources to match actual usage. This practice prevents over-provisioning and reduces unnecessary costs. It’s a practical approach.
Additionally, implementing automated scaling can optimize resource allocation based on demand fluctuations. This strategy ensures that businesses only pay for what they need. It’s a wise financial decision.
